Transaction 5faa7b92e2a9497675b7a8e1cf528d38ffc30d6a5f35ee6fa7a0c84f2ca968c3
1 Input
1 Output
-
5faa7b92e2a9497675b7a8e1cf528d38ffc30d6a5f35ee6fa7a0c84f2ca968c3:0
- value
- 20918628
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e70b60e04b7b2b8b1b5b6a3f8030a26bdd110b0
- address
- bc1q8ectvrsyk7et3vd4k63lsqc2y67azy9s8s0e8z